War within the Middle East
Appeals to Israel for restraint after Iran assault

Iran's assault on Israel was an unprecedented escalation of the 2 nations' lengthy battle. It remains to be unclear how Israel will react to this – the allies hope for prudence.

There are growing calls internationally for Israel to react with restraint to Iran's unprecedented assault. Chancellor Olaf Scholz known as on Israel to contribute to de-escalation. Foreign Minister Annalena Baerbock warned that retribution just isn’t a class in worldwide legislation.

French President Emmanuel Macron mentioned they needed to persuade Israel {that a} response to the Iranian assault shouldn’t be additional escalation. “We will do everything we can to prevent a conflagration, i.e. an escalation,” mentioned the top of state on French tv.

According to its personal statements, the USA had beforehand urged Israel to fastidiously take into account a doable retaliatory strike towards Iran and its penalties.

War Cabinet deliberations awaited

Iran's first direct assault on Israel over the weekend has introduced the 2 arch-enemies to the brink of armed battle. It is unclear how Israel will reply to the unprecedented air assault with drones, rockets and cruise missiles, which was largely repelled with the assist of different states. Another assembly of the Israeli War Cabinet was anticipated on Monday. The cupboard will meet for a second time inside 24 hours on Monday afternoon, reported the information web site ynet and the every day newspaper “Haaretz”.

The conflict cupboard, headed by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u, had already met on Sunday. According to media experiences, no determination was made on a doable response throughout three hours of deliberations. However, a number of choices for a doable Israeli retaliation have been mentioned on the assembly. Within the Israeli authorities, very right-wing authorities politicians particularly are calling for fast and hard motion. However, the hardliners should not represented within the conflict cupboard.

Cameron: Restraint can be a double defeat for Iran

“The best thing you can do in the case of Israel is to recognize that this has been a failure for Iran,” British Foreign Secretary David Cameron instructed Times Radio. As an unbiased, sovereign nation, Israel has each proper to answer such an assault. But Great Britain additionally desires to keep away from escalation and advises “our friends in Israel that it is time to think with both our heads and our hearts.”

If Israel now holds again, it will be tantamount to a double defeat for Iran, mentioned Cameron. “Not only was its attack an almost complete failure, but the rest of the world can now see the malign influence (Iran) has on the region and understand its true nature.”

Scholz: Success shouldn’t be given away

The Chancellor, who was in Shanghai on Monday, made comparable feedback. The largely profitable protection towards round 300 drones and missiles was “a success that perhaps shouldn’t be wasted,” mentioned the SPD politician. “Hence our advice to contribute to de-escalation yourself.”

Scholz additionally once more warned Iran. The first-ever assault on Israeli territory was a “bad escalation” that ought to not have occurred, he mentioned. “Iran cannot continue to treat this like this.”

USA: Carefully take into account doable retaliation

On Sunday evening, Iran immediately attacked its declared arch-enemy Israel for the primary time within the historical past of the Islamic Republic and portrayed the assault as retaliation for the killing of high-ranking officers in Syria. On April 1, two brigadier generals have been killed in a suspected Israeli-led airstrike on the Iranian embassy compound in Syria's capital Damascus.

US President Biden spoke to Netanyahu on the telephone on Sunday evening shortly after Iran's assault started and made it “very clear” that we would have liked to “think carefully and strategically about the risks of escalation.” This was reported by a high-ranking US authorities official in Washington on Sunday. The USA, as Israel's most necessary ally, had helped repel Iran's main assault towards Israel.
